随着区块链技术的快速发展,越来越多的人开始关注数字货币相关项目的开发。BitP作为一种新兴的数字货币平台,吸引了广泛的关注。如果你正在考虑如何开发BitP,那么本文将为你提供一个全面的指南,包括BitP的基本概念、开发流程以及常见问题的解答,帮助你深入了解这一领域。
BitP是一种基于区块链技术的平台,旨在提供快速、安全的数字货币交易服务。它允许用户在全球范围内进行实时交易,且具有去中心化的特性,使用户可以更好地控制自己的资金。BitP不仅支持传统的购物功能,还能与智能合约实现无缝对接,从而在各种应用场景中展现出强大的生命力。
在开发BitP之前,首先需要对区块链技术有一定的了解。这包括对分布式账本、加密算法和共识机制的基本知识。此外,还需要熟悉数字货币的经济模型和生态系统,审慎分析市场需求,以便在开发中做出明智的决策。
开发BitP的流程可以分为以下几个主要步骤:
在开发任何软件之前,进行市场调研是必不可少的。了解当前市场上已有的竞争产品、用户需求、法律法规等,能够为后续开发提供重要的参考数据。通过问卷调查、访谈等方式收集相关信息,可以更好地理解目标用户的需求。
在明确了市场需求后,接下来需要设计BitP的技术架构。一般来说,BitP的技术架构包括前端和后端两部分。前端部分是用户所见的界面,需要考虑用户体验和界面设计;后端部分则包括数据库、服务器和与区块链的交互逻辑等,需确保数据的安全性和交易的高效性。
设计完成后,便进入编码阶段。需要选择合适的编程语言和开发工具。常用的区块链开发语言有Solidity、JavaScript和Python等。同时,需要关注代码的可读性和可维护性,确保代码在后期能够方便升级和更新。
在编码完成后,必须进行充分的测试,以确保系统能够稳定运行。这一阶段应包括功能测试、安全测试、性能测试以及用户测试。测试完成后,根据反馈对系统进行,以提升用户体验和产品性能。
在完成所有测试并进行相应的改进后,可以将BitP进行部署和发布。在此之前,需要准备好相关的市场营销策略,以吸引用户快速加入。同时,建立良好的客户服务体系,以处理用户在使用过程中遇到的各种问题。
产品发布后,并不意味着开发工作结束。后续的运营和维护同样至关重要。包括监控系统性能、处理用户反馈、定期更新和增加新功能等。运营团队需要时刻关注用户的需求变化,以保持产品的竞争力。
BitP的盈利模式可以从多个方面进行探讨。首先,交易手续费是BitP平台的重要收入来源。每当用户在平台进行交易时,BitP都能收取一定的手续费。此外,BitP还可以通过提供增值服务盈利,例如数字钱包的安全升级、充值服务等。
其次,BitP可以与其他企业进行战略合作,提供API接口或技术支持,从而获得额外的收入。随着生态系统的逐渐完善,BitP还能够通过推出更多的金融产品和服务,如借贷、分期付款等,进一步增加盈利渠道。
此外,BitP也可以利用自身的用户数据进行市场分析和广告投放,制造商业价值。这些多元化的盈利模式能确保BitP在市场中的持续发展。
开发BitP过程中,需要特别关注各国的法律法规,不同国家对于数字货币的监管政策差异较大。因此,开发团队在产品设计初期应该充分了解目标市场相关的法律法规,确保所开发的产品合规。
例如,有些国家对数字货币的发行存在严格限制,而其他一些国家则可能对ICO(首次代币发行)持开放态度。此外,反洗钱(AML)和了解客户(KYC)政策也需要给予足够重视,以保障平台的安全性和信任度。
咨询专业的法律顾问,经常与法律合规部门沟通,可以有效规避潜在的法律风险。在开发过程中,需要始终保持对法律合规的高度关注,以确保项目的长期成功。
在数字货币行业中,安全性是重中之重。如果不能保证用户资金的安全,整个项目都可能面临失败的风险。因此,在开发BitP时,必须采取相应的安全措施。
首先,要对用户的资金进行分类存储,采用冷钱包和热钱包相结合的方式,确保绝大部分资金处于冷钱包中,以避免黑客攻击带来的风险。此外,定期进行安全审计,及时修复潜在的系统漏洞,增强系统的安全性。
其次,建立完善的用户身份验证机制,通过技术手段保障用户的身份安全。可以考虑使用双重认证和生物识别技术,以提高保障级别。并且,对于大额交易,建议引入人工审核机制,增强风险控制。
此外,还需要对用户进行安全教育,使用户了解基本的安全常识,倡导他们定期更改密码,注意 phishing 攻击等潜在风险,从源头上减少安全隐患。
Customer feedback and community engagement are crucial for the success of BitP. First, establishing channels for users to provide feedback is essential. This can include forums, support tickets, or social media groups where users can voice their opinions and suggestions readily.
Regularly analyzing user feedback helps identify potential issues and areas for improvement. It's also vital to respond promptly to user inquiries and complaints, showcasing the team's dedication to user satisfaction. This responsiveness builds trust and encourages more users to engage actively with the platform.
Moreover, actively participating in community discussions, such as AMAs (Ask Me Anything) or webinars, can further enhance community engagement. These interactions allow developers to explain new features, plan future updates, and listen to user concerns directly, fostering a strong bond between the product team and its user base.
Lastly, consider implementing a reward system for users who provide valuable feedback or contribute positively to the community. This could include tokens, merchandise, or even exclusive access to new features, incentivizing active participation and continuous improvement of the BitP platform.
通过这些内容,我们希望能够为你提供一个全面的BitP开发指南,帮助你在这一领域取得成功。如果你在开发过程中遇到任何问题,欢迎随时向我们咨询。